Full Story
Versace is celebrating the 20th anniversary of its DV One watch with a special edition release, limited to just 240 pieces. This commemorative timepiece marks two decades since the original was first unveiled.
Launched in 2005, the DV One was a landmark creation for Versace, representing the brand’s inaugural foray into high-tech ceramic watchmaking. Its design epitomised the boldness of the early 2000s, characterized by a striking case, sleek black finish, the iconic Medusa logo, and intricate Greca elements, all of which helped establish Versace’s distinctive stance in the realm of Swiss luxury watches.
The new 2025 edition retains the ceramic construction of its predecessor while incorporating significant enhancements. The watch features a 40mm black ceramic case complemented by a coordinated ceramic bracelet. Notably, it now hosts a Swiss-made automatic movement, the Landeron DP24, a notable departure from the mechanisms used in previous DV One models.
Modifications are also evident on the watch dial, which distinguishes itself from the original. It showcases a black enamel base adorned with a gold-tone 3D Barocco motif inspired by Versace’s rich design history. The dial includes four diamonds as hour markers, with an additional diamond set in the crown, while the Versace logo is positioned at 3 o’clock, adding a touch of opulence to the design.
Visible through the caseback is a black rotor engraved with the phrase “DV ONE – 20th Anniversary Limited Edition,” underscoring the exclusivity of this release.
The anniversary edition is priced at $4,550 and is available for purchase on the Versace website.
